charset=us-ascii Content-Disposition: inline In-Reply-To: <20241130153310.3349484-1-guoren@kernel.org> On Sat, Nov 30, 2024 at 10:33:10AM -0500, guoren@kernel.org wrote: > From: Guo Ren > > When CONFIG_DEBUG_RT_MUTEXES=y, mutex_lock->rt_mutex_try_acquire > would change from rt_mutex_cmpxchg_acquire to > rt_mutex_slowtrylock(): > raw_spin_lock_irqsave(&lock->wait_lock, flags); > ret = __rt_mutex_slowtrylock(lock); > raw_spin_unlock_irqrestore(&lock->wait_lock, flags); > > Because queued_spin_#ops to ticket_#ops is changed one by one by > jump_label, raw_spin_lock/unlock would cause a deadlock during the > changing. > > That means in arch/riscv/kernel/jump_label.c: > 1. > arch_jump_label_transform_queue() -> > mutex_lock(&text_mutex); +-> raw_spin_lock -> queued_spin_lock > |-> raw_spin_unlock -> queued_spin_unlock > patch_insn_write -> change the raw_spin_lock to ticket_lock > mutex_unlock(&text_mutex); > ... > > 2. /* Dirty the lock value */ > arch_jump_label_transform_queue() -> > mutex_lock(&text_mutex); +-> raw_spin_lock -> *ticket_lock* > |-> raw_spin_unlock -> *queued_spin_unlock* > /* BUG: ticket_lock with queued_spin_unlock */ > patch_insn_write -> change the raw_spin_unlock to ticket_unlock > mutex_unlock(&text_mutex); > ... > > 3. /* Dead lock */ > arch_jump_label_transform_queue() -> > mutex_lock(&text_mutex); +-> raw_spin_lock -> ticket_lock /* deadlock! */ > |-> raw_spin_unlock -> ticket_unlock > patch_insn_write -> change other raw_spin_#op -> ticket_#op > mutex_unlock(&text_mutex); > > So, the solution is to disable mutex usage of > arch_jump_label_transform_queue() during early_boot_irqs_disabled, just > like we have done for stop_machine. > > Reported-by: Conor Dooley > Signed-off-by: Guo Ren > Signed-off-by: Guo Ren > Fixes: ab83647fadae ("riscv: Add qspinlock support") > Link: https://lore.kernel.org/linux-riscv/CAJF2gTQwYTGinBmCSgVUoPv0_q4EPt_+WiyfUA1HViAKgUzxAg@mail.gmail.com/T/#mf488e6347817fca03bb93a7d34df33d8615b3775 > Cc: Palmer Dabbelt > Cc: Alexandre Ghiti Tested-by: Nam Cao Thanks for the fix, Nam
